The Early Years: Building the Foundation

Our story begins in Thal, Austria, a small village where Arnold was born in 1947. Life wasn’t always easy for young Arnold. Growing up, he faced the typical challenges of a post-war childhood, but he also had a dream. From a young age, he was fascinated by bodybuilding and the idea of transforming his body. He wasn't just interested; he was obsessed. This early passion became the driving force that would shape his entire life. He started weight training at the tender age of 15, dedicating himself to the gruelling workouts and strict diet required to build muscle.

His dedication quickly paid off. He started winning local competitions and soon caught the eye of the bodybuilding world. In 1967, at the age of 20, he won the Junior Mr. Europe contest. This was just the beginning. Arnold's relentless work ethic and unwavering commitment propelled him to the top of the bodybuilding world. He moved to the United States and began training at iconic gyms like Gold's Gym in Venice, California. These gyms became his second home, a place where he honed his skills and built a network of like-minded individuals. Arnold's focus and determination were unmatched. He was always looking for ways to improve, whether it was refining his workout routines, studying nutrition, or learning from the best in the business. Hollywood Calling: From Barbarian to Blockbuster

Arnold's transition to Hollywood wasn't immediate, but when it happened, it was explosive. He didn't start with lead roles; his early film appearances were often small parts that showcased his impressive physique. Films like ā€œHercules in New Yorkā€ (1970) gave him the initial exposure needed to build his career. But it was his roles in action films that truly catapulted him to stardom. Films like ā€œConan the Barbarianā€ (1982) and ā€œThe Terminatorā€ (1984) made him a household name. These films were incredibly popular, not only because of their thrilling plots but also because of Arnold's commanding screen presence. His strong, muscular physique perfectly suited the action-hero roles, and his delivery of memorable one-liners became iconic.

Entering the Political Arena: Governor of California

Okay, folks, this is where things get really interesting. In 2003, Arnold Schwarzenegger decided to run for Governor of California. Yes, you read that right. The action movie star, the guy known for his biceps and catchphrases, was running for one of the most powerful political positions in the United States. It was a bold move, to say the least.

The context was also pretty wild. He entered the race during a recall election against then-Governor Gray Davis. This recall election created an unusual opportunity for anyone to run, and Arnold saw his chance. He announced his candidacy on ā€œThe Tonight Show with Jay Lenoā€, a move that perfectly captured his ability to capture the public's attention.

Political Campaign and Election

The campaign was a media spectacle. Arnold's celebrity status made him an instant frontrunner. He ran as a Republican, promising to bring change and fix the state's economic woes. He was a breath of fresh air for many Californians who were tired of the status quo. His campaign was a combination of celebrity and substance. He used his fame to draw massive crowds and generate media coverage, but he also focused on key issues such as the economy, education, and the environment. His campaign slogan, ā€œI’ll be back,ā€ was a nod to his Terminator role and captured the public's imagination.

Despite having no prior political experience, Schwarzenegger was able to harness his popularity and charm to win the election. He defeated a crowded field of candidates and became the 38th Governor of California. His victory was a huge upset, and it sent shockwaves through the political world. Governor Schwarzenegger: The Political Journey

Once in office, Governor Schwarzenegger faced a host of challenges. California was grappling with a massive budget deficit, and the state's economy was struggling. He immediately took on the tough issues, negotiating with the state legislature, and making a series of decisions that were both praised and criticised. He adopted a moderate political stance, often working across party lines to achieve his goals. He made it clear that he was going to run the state like a business, focusing on efficiency and results.

Policy and Achievements

During his time in office, Schwarzenegger implemented several notable policies. He championed environmental initiatives, including the Global Warming Solutions Act of 2006, which aimed to reduce greenhouse gas emissions. He also focused on education reform and worked to improve the state's infrastructure. He was a hands-on governor, often getting involved in the details of policy and legislation. His administration was characterized by a willingness to challenge the status quo and a commitment to making California a better place.

One of the biggest challenges he faced was the state's ongoing budget crisis. He had to make tough decisions, including cutting spending and raising taxes. His leadership style, which was marked by a strong personality and a willingness to take risks, often put him at odds with the state legislature. While he was praised for his efforts to improve the state's economy and environmental policies, he was also criticised for his sometimes-controversial decisions and his reliance on celebrity.
